Under general supervision of the Manager and New York City Housing Authority (NYCHA) Leased Housing Department policies and procedures, the Housing Assistant will perform work in a timely and efficient manner to ensure prompt response to program requests while maintaining compliance with applicable policies, procedures, and regulations.
Specific duties include, but are not limited to:
1. Process case suspensions, terminations, move-outs, and restorations in accordance with program policies, state and federal regulations, and HUD guidelines.
2. Conduct case reviews, including verification of household composition and income calculations.
3. Process participant transfer requests in compliance with established procedures.
4. Evaluate and process reasonable accommodation requests and payment adjustments.
5. Perform income and employment verifications using appropriate third-party documentation methods.
6. Create, review, and process payment adjustments accurately and timely.
7. Communicate program rules, regulations, and requirements to current and former participants clearly and professionally.
8. Review, respond to, and process information requests and correspondence.
9. Identify system performance issues and recommend enhancements or process improvements related to case management.
10.Maintain accurate and complete case documentation in the program system.
11.Perform other related duties as assigned.
